    Splash Mountain. I'm a terrified little boy who sees the drop and am reassured by my family that it's a different ride we were waiting in line for. Sure enough, I fell for it. I was traumatized for almost a decade after that and would never dare go on it until I was 17.... now it's nothing and I can ride it over and over. Great memories!!

    My first ride was Small World -- in New York -- in 1964. But the first ride I remember at the parks, was at DisneyLand, the one that shrunk you to microscopic size. I think it was later replaced with Captain EO.
